Crafting Personalized Experiences Through Customer Data

CRM technology: Effective customer relationship management hinges…

Effective customer relationship management hinges on the ability to gather, analyze, and leverage customer data to create highly personalized experiences. Modern CRM systems excel at centralizing customer information from various touchpoints, including sales interactions, marketing campaigns, customer service inquiries, and even social media activity. This unified view allows businesses to gain a deeper understanding of each customer’s individual needs and preferences. By analyzing this data, companies can identify patterns, predict future behavior, and segment their customer base for targeted marketing efforts. Personalized experiences, such as tailored product recommendations, customized email campaigns, and proactive customer service interventions, demonstrate to customers that they are valued and understood. This, in turn, fosters a stronger sense of loyalty and encourages repeat business.

Furthermore, the insights derived from customer data can inform product development and service improvements. By analyzing customer feedback and identifying pain points, businesses can proactively address issues and enhance their offerings to better meet customer needs. This continuous cycle of data analysis, personalization, and improvement is crucial for maintaining a competitive edge and building long-term customer relationships. Consider, for instance, a retail company using CRM data to identify a trend of customers frequently returning a specific product due to sizing issues. Armed with this information, the company can work with its suppliers to address the sizing problem, update its product descriptions, or even offer personalized sizing recommendations to customers before they make a purchase. This proactive approach not only reduces returns but also demonstrates a commitment to customer satisfaction.

Leveraging Marketing Automation with CRM Technology

CRM technology: Marketing automation, when integrated with…

Marketing automation, when integrated with CRM technology, becomes a powerful engine for delivering targeted and relevant messages to customers and prospects at the right time. CRM provides the foundation for understanding customer behavior, preferences, and purchase history, while marketing automation tools enable businesses to create personalized campaigns that nurture leads and drive conversions. This integration allows for the creation of segmented email lists, personalized landing pages, and automated workflows that respond to specific customer actions. For example, a customer who abandons their shopping cart on an e-commerce website can automatically receive a follow-up email offering a discount or free shipping to encourage them to complete their purchase. This type of targeted messaging is far more effective than generic marketing blasts and demonstrates a genuine understanding of the customer’s needs.

Beyond email marketing, marketing automation can be used to personalize the entire customer journey. By tracking website activity, social media interactions, and other touchpoints, businesses can create dynamic content that adapts to each customer’s individual profile. This personalized approach can significantly improve engagement and conversion rates. Imagine a software company using marketing automation to nurture leads. A prospect who downloads a white paper on a specific topic might then receive a series of targeted emails highlighting relevant features and benefits of the company’s software. This personalized approach ensures that the prospect receives the information they need to make an informed decision. Moreover, marketing automation allows businesses to scale their marketing efforts without sacrificing personalization. By automating repetitive tasks, such as email follow-ups and lead scoring, marketing teams can focus on creating more strategic campaigns and building stronger customer relationships.

Streamlining Sales Processes for Enhanced Customer Engagement

CRM technology: A modern CRM system is…

A modern CRM system is not just a tool for marketing; it’s a central hub for managing the entire sales process, from lead generation to closing deals. By providing sales teams with a comprehensive view of each customer and prospect, CRM empowers them to engage in more meaningful and productive interactions. Sales representatives can access information about a customer’s past purchases, interactions with the company, and current needs, allowing them to tailor their approach and provide personalized solutions. This level of personalization can significantly improve sales effectiveness and build stronger customer relationships. For example, a sales representative who knows that a prospect is interested in a specific product feature can focus their presentation on that feature, highlighting its benefits and addressing any concerns the prospect may have.

CRM technology: Furthermore, CRM systems automate many…

Furthermore, CRM systems automate many of the time-consuming tasks that sales teams typically face, such as lead qualification, data entry, and follow-up scheduling. This automation frees up sales representatives to focus on building relationships and closing deals. By automating lead qualification, CRM can help sales teams prioritize their efforts and focus on the most promising prospects. Automated follow-up reminders ensure that no lead is left behind and that customers receive timely and relevant communication. In addition, CRM provides valuable insights into sales performance, allowing managers to track key metrics such as sales cycle length, conversion rates, and deal size. This data-driven approach enables sales teams to identify areas for improvement and optimize their strategies.

Driving Customer Loyalty Through Proactive Support

CRM technology: Customer support is no longer…

Customer support is no longer just about resolving issues; it’s an opportunity to build loyalty and strengthen customer relationships. Modern CRM systems empower businesses to provide proactive and personalized support that exceeds customer expectations. By integrating customer service channels, such as phone, email, chat, and social media, CRM provides a unified view of customer interactions, allowing support representatives to quickly understand a customer’s history and needs. This eliminates the need for customers to repeat themselves and ensures that they receive consistent and informed support. For example, a customer who contacts support via chat can seamlessly transition to a phone call without having to re-explain their issue, as the representative has access to the entire chat history. This level of convenience and efficiency can significantly improve customer satisfaction.

Proactive support involves anticipating customer needs and addressing potential issues before they arise. CRM can be used to identify customers who are at risk of churn or who are experiencing difficulties with a product or service. By proactively reaching out to these customers, businesses can demonstrate their commitment to customer satisfaction and prevent potential problems from escalating. For instance, a software company might use CRM to identify customers who haven’t logged into their account in a while. They can then proactively reach out to these customers, offering assistance and reminding them of the value of their subscription. In addition, CRM can be used to personalize support interactions based on a customer’s individual profile and preferences. This can involve tailoring the language used, offering relevant solutions, and providing personalized recommendations.
